Agentic AI vs. Classic AI: What’s Gap

Concerning decades, conventional AI has focused on particular assignments – think image detection or routine client support. Nevertheless, agentic AI presents a notable change. It's not only about completing a particular role; rather, it's built to grasp targets, plan actions, and autonomously function to achieve them, frequently adjusting to new conditions. Fundamentally, autonomous AI represents a level of autonomy which conventional AI merely lacks.
